A powerful switch hitter, Mark Teixeira was one of the most feared hitters in college baseball before turning pro. He tore up minor league pitching in short order and quickly established himself in the big leagues, where his impact is just being felt. Mark is sure to be one of the premier sluggers of his generation.

Mark wears #23 in honor of his favorite baseball player from childhood, Don Mattingly.
